Etnis Tionghoa telah menjadi bagian dari masyarakat Indonesia dengan berbagai dinamikanya. Perubahan kebijakan yang terjadi pada beberapa kekuasaan yang  lampau telah berdampak pada perubahan sikap masyarakat keturunan etnis Cina  yang mengalami dilemma baik dalam konteks sosial, ekonomi, maupun religi dibandingkan dengan golongan masyarakat Indonesia lainnya.  Bagaimana mereka mampu menghadapi berbagai situasi tersebut merupakan kasus yang menarik untuk diobeservasi. Melalu studi pustaka dan pendekatan strategi kebudayaan Van Peursen, diketahui middle man menjadi strategi yang dipilih dalam menghadapi serba ketidakpastian di masa lampau. Strategi tersebut hingga kini masih menjadi tantangan mengingat hubungan sejarah masyarakat keturunan Cina di Indonesia masih meninggalkan riak-riak dan stigma yang berkepanjangan.

Green tea can influence the gut microbiota by either stimulating the growth of specific species or by hindering the development of detrimental ones. At the same time, gut bacteria can metabolize green tea compounds and produce smaller bioactive molecules. Accordingly, green tea benefits could be due to beneficial bacteria or to microbial bioactive metabolites. Therefore, the gut microbiota is likely to act as middle man for, at least, some of the green tea benefits on health. Many health promoting effects of green tea seems to be related to the inter-relation between green tea and gut microbiota. Green tea has proven to be able to correct the microbial dysbiosis that appears during several conditions such as obesity or cancer. On the other hand, tea compounds influence the growth of bacterial species involved in inflammatory processes such as the release of LPS or the modulation of IL production; thus, influencing the development of different chronic diseases. There are many studies trying to link either green tea or green tea phenolic compounds to health benefits via gut microbiota. In this review, we tried to summarize the most recent research in the area.

This article describes the “Blockchain” which is an upcoming technology in the current leading world and which serves as a capital market use-cases for many of the global Fintech industries across the world, is a distributed ledger of economic transactions which not only used for recording financial transactions but mostly everything of value in this world. In the current world, mostly all the transactions are done through online which mainly includes the bank as a “middle man,” which could be untrustworthy at times. Blockchain comes into the picture which eliminates the need of a middle man or third party between the users who are involved in the transactions. Represents a financial ledger entry of data structure which consists of record of transactions which is digitally signed and cannot be tampered as authenticity is ensured in which the ledger is considered to be of high integrity. One of the leading and highly valued platform of blockchain is “Hyperledger Fabric” which is meant for securing transactions and serves a powerful container technology for smart contract development in the global capital firms. The potential of Blockchain and DLT in capital markets in this upcoming world could remove many of the inefficiencies and costs inherent in the global capital markets across the world and could be considered as a viable technology which enable to settlement.
